PGP Desktop for OS X now supports Intel-based Apple computers. Using PGP is the preferred method of exchanging encrypted files with Windows users since PGP is easier to use than Gnu Privacy Guard (GPG). The instructions below are for people who had previously installed GPG and have not yet installed PGP.
